We just returned home after a 4 day trip to the coast stopping in San Sebastian, an ancient mining town. Unfortunately when we reached the coast it was windy, overcast and cool. We did manage to visit Lynda in Bucerias, then drive over to Sayulita and Lo de Marcos. Despite the bad coastal weather San Sebastian was picturesque, uplifting and a real highlight for all of us. The country side along highway 70 to PV is gorgeous, surrounded by mountains, wild flowers and majestic scenery. Perhaps 4 days was not long enough but we are delighted to be home in our casita!
